How they compare

Jordan currently reports 44.6% against 43.9% in Honduras, a difference of 0.7%.

The two have swapped places 12 times across 60 shared years of data; in 1965 it was Jordan ahead.

Honduras ranks 63rd and Jordan ranks 61st of 201 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Honduras averaged higher in 1 and Jordan in 6.

Head to head by decade

Decade Honduras Jordan Difference Ahead
1960s 19.9% 21.5% 1.6% Jordan
1970s 24.9% 35.3% 10.5% Jordan
1980s 20.2% 46.3% 26.1% Jordan
1990s 31.4% 54.9% 23.5% Jordan
2000s 47.5% 64.0% 16.6% Jordan
2010s 45.1% 49.5% 4.4% Jordan
2020s 45.7% 43.3% 2.4% Honduras

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
